The 10 Telltale Signs Of A Periodic Function: A Closer Look
So what exactly is it about periodic functions that makes them so fascinating? Here are the top 10 telltale signs that can help you spot them:
-
– Repeating patterns: Periodic functions are characterized by repeating patterns, whether it’s the cycles of the seasons or the beats of a pulsating rhythm.
– Regular intervals: These patterns occur at regular intervals, creating a sense of predictability and order.
– Oscillatory behavior: Periodic functions often exhibit oscillatory behavior, with a steady increase or decrease followed by a reversal.
– Symmetry: Many periodic functions exhibit symmetry, either around a central point or in a more complex, fractal-like pattern.
– Periodicity: Of course, one of the defining features of periodic functions is their periodicity – they repeat themselves over a fixed interval.
– Cycles: Periodic functions can be broken down into smaller cycles, each with its own unique characteristics.
– Phases: Each cycle within a periodic function can be thought of as a phase, with its own distinct features and patterns.
– Amplitudes: The amplitude of a periodic function refers to the maximum value it achieves during a cycle.
– Shifts: Periodic functions can be shifted up or down, either horizontally or vertically, to create new patterns and relationships.
– Frequency: Finally, the frequency of a periodic function refers to the number of cycles it completes over a fixed interval.
